SoloPi 初体验 之 环境搭建

一、下载适用于 Mac SDK Platform-Tools
https://dl.google.com/android/repository/platform-tools-latest-darwin.zip

检查是不是配置安卓环境变量:echo $ANDROID_SDK
如果没有配置,则增加配置: vim ~/.bash_profile
追加三条配置

export ANDROID_SDK=/Users/best.fei/Library/Android/sdk
export PATH=${PATH}:${ANDROID_SDK}/platform-tools
export PATH=${PATH}:${ANDROID_SDK}/tools

生效配置:source ~/.bash_profile

可以参考这个文章进行配置:Mac Android Studio配置
注意:如果不是跑SoloPi源码的话,其实只需要安装adb命令就好

二、连接设备并开启wifi调试端口
1、使用命令 adb devices 检查是否连接上设备
2、使用命令 adb tcpip 5555 开启无线ADB调试模式
通常设备会显示restarting in TCP mode port: 5555来提示手机已开启无线ADB调试模式

  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
### 回答1: Solopi是一款网络可视化工具,可以实现网络拓扑构建和监控,但是它本身并不能模拟弱网环境。模拟弱网环境通常需要使用专业的网络模拟器,比如shunra、GNS3等。这些网络模拟器可以在虚拟环境中模拟各种不同的网络场景,包括弱网环境、高延迟网络、网络拥塞等,以帮助开发人员和测试人员模拟真实的网络环境,更好地评估和测试应用程序的性能和稳定性。 当然,Solopi可以通过监控网络流量和性能指标,及时发现网络性能问题并进行分析和优化。在实际应用中,Solopi可以与其他工具结合使用,如网络流量生成器、协议分析器等,以实现更全面的网络测试和优化。 ### 回答2: Solopi是一款常用的性能测试工具,它可以模拟各种网络环境下的性能表现,包括带宽、延迟、丢包等问题。因此,Solopi当然也可以模拟弱网环境。 Solopi通过模拟不同的网络带宽、延迟和丢包率等参数,可以让开发者模拟各种实际应用场景,以测试软件在各种网络条件下的性能表现。在逐步增加网络带宽和延迟等参数的情况下,我们可以让Solopi模拟更为恶劣的网络环境,从而测试软件在较为恶劣网络环境下的表现和稳定性。在测试时,Solopi会生成相应的测试报告,开发者可以根据这些报告来发现软件在弱网环境下存在的问题,以便及时修复。 总之,Solopi可以非常准确地模拟各种网络环境,包括弱网环境。这使得开发者可以更好地测试软件在各种网络条件下的稳定性和表现,从而使软件更加可靠,性能更佳。 ### 回答3: Solopi是一款性能测试工具,它可以用于测试软件系统的可靠性、稳定性和性能。Solopi可以通过不同的功能模块以及配置参数来模拟各种场景,包括高并发、高负载、大数据量等等,以验证系统的性能表现。其中就包括模拟弱网环境。 在Solopi中,模拟弱网环境可以通过配置网络带宽、延迟和丢包率等参数来实现。通过调整这些参数,Solopi可以模拟不同的弱网场景,包括网络拥塞、带宽限制、高延迟等,进而测试系统在这些环境下的响应能力、稳定性和可靠性。 例如,在模拟网络拥塞场景时,可以配置Solopi的丢包率增加或带宽降低等参数,从而让系统在网络拥塞时也能够保持良好的性能表现。或者,在模拟高延迟场景时,可以增加延迟时间,以验证系统在高延迟环境下的响应时间和可靠性。 综上所述,Solopi能够模拟弱网环境,并通过调整不同的参数来模拟不同的场景,以验证系统在这些场景下的性能表现。

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值